I'm of the opinion that Discus should be round. I think that the wilds we see with pointy faces are that way because they have had to work for a living. If they had been given the conditions we give them in our aquariums many would have round faces. With Discus, good shape is as dependent on lots of food from a young age as it is to genetics.
